首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从ANT NetBeans Platform应用程序中获取要在调试器控制台中显示的输出

从ANT NetBeans Platform应用程序中获取要在调试器控制台中显示的输出,可以通过以下步骤实现:

  1. 在NetBeans中打开ANT构建文件(通常是build.xml)。
  2. 在构建文件中找到你想要获取输出的目标(target)或任务(task)。
  3. 在目标或任务中添加一个输出属性(output attribute),用于指定输出的位置和文件名。例如:
代码语言:txt
复制
<target name="myTarget" output="output.txt">
    <!-- 目标的内容 -->
</target>
  1. 在目标或任务的执行过程中,将输出的内容写入指定的文件中。可以使用ANT的echo任务或其他适当的任务来实现。例如:
代码语言:txt
复制
<target name="myTarget" output="output.txt">
    <echo message="Hello, World!" file="output.txt"/>
</target>
  1. 运行ANT构建文件,执行目标或任务。输出的内容将被写入指定的文件中。
  2. 在NetBeans中打开调试器视图(Debugging view),选择你的应用程序的调试会话。
  3. 在调试器控制台中,可以看到输出文件中的内容。

这样,你就可以从ANT NetBeans Platform应用程序中获取要在调试器控制台中显示的输出了。

注意:以上步骤是一种常见的方法,具体实现可能会因应用程序的结构和需求而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

14款Java开发工具【面试+工作】

初学者角度来看,采用JDK开发Java程序能够很快理解程序各部分代码之间关系,有利于理解Java面向对象设计思想。...另外,在构建任何 BEA WebLogic Platform 应用,Java 控件不仅可扩展而且完全相同。...除了解由扩展点定义接口外,插件不知道它们通过扩展点提供服务将如何被使用。   利用Eclipse,我们可以将高级设计(也许是采用UML)与低级开发工具(如应用调试器等)结合在一起。...这个可选包可以你下载Ant同一个地方下载。ANT本身就是这样一个流程脚本引擎,用于自动化调用程序完成项目的编译,打包,测试等。...2.按Ctrl-N再键入类名字可以快速地在编辑器里打开任何一个类。显示出来下拉列表里选择类。同样方法你可以通过使用Ctrl-Shift-N打开工程非Java文件。

2.3K50

包教包会,手把手教你配置NetBeans IDE

本文将详细介绍如何配置 NetBeans IDE,以提高开发效率。 1. 安装 NetBeans 1.1 下载与安装 访问 NetBeans 官方网站,选择适合您操作系统版本下载。...1.2 初次启动 启动 NetBeans 后,您将看到欢迎界面。可以选择创建新项目、打开已有项目或版本控制系统克隆项目。 2....6.3 使用 Git 插件 NetBeans 提供了丰富 Git 支持,包括文件历史、分支管理、冲突解决等。 您可以在项目中右键点击文件或目录,选择 Git 菜单进行常见版本控制操作。 7....调试配置 7.1 配置调试器 打开设置:导航到 Java -> Debugger,配置调试选项。 常用设置包括配置断点、调试视图和调试控制台。...在项目属性中导航到 Libraries,确保配置了正确 JDK。 12.3 调试无法启动 检查调试配置是否正确,确保选择了合适解释器和调试器。 更新调试器依赖包,以确保兼容性。

10110

Java 8,Jenkins,Jacoco和Sonar进行持续集成

因此,我团队开始进行“概念验证”,以表明以下技术已准备好协同工作: Java 8, NetBeans 8.0 & Ant JUnit 4 & Jacoco 0.7.1 Jenkins & Sonar...请注意,该证明已在Windows 7开发人员机器上完成,但很容易做到。在Linux服务器也是如此。 下图高层次显示了将在帖子描述体系结构。 ?...Java 8 & NetBeans 8.0 & Ant 我们正在创建模块化应用程序。该应用程序具有多层体系结构,其中每个层都是模块套件,而最终可执行文件只是一组集成套件。...定义另一项任务是jacoco合并,该合并实际上将获取每个模块所有生成exec,并将它们合并到套件构建中单个exec,以允许声纳进行分析。...创建一个新自由样式项目,配置您首选项版本控制,然后在“构建”面板添加以下三个“ Invoce Ant”任务: ?

1.8K10

如何使用谷歌浏览器 Chrome 更好地调试

要了解有关此功能更多信息,请访问文档。 table() - 将数组输出为表 数据库或外部 API 获取数据时,它通常以对象数组形式出现。...想象一下,你正试图在你 chrome 控制台中预览或读取此返回数据,以找出在你应用程序不起作用内容。该console.log()函数通常将其显示为难以阅读或分类文本输出。...Chrome 允许你直接控制台执行此操作,而无需使用 debug() 函数访问你源代码。只需在控制台中调用它并将函数名称传递给它,它就会自动将调试器注入到函数,让你可以单步调试代码。...在控制台中调用debug(functionReference)会增加一个调试器;引用函数声明第一行上语句。 DevTools 还提供断点,让你逐行执行代码。...在这篇文章,我们研究了如何通过使用 Google Chrome DevTools 直接在浏览器中进行调试来提高调试技能。希望这将使你能够更高效地对 Web 应用程序和组件进行故障排除。

3.5K30

跨平台PHP调试器设计及使用方法——拾遗

之前七篇博文讲解了跨平台PHP调试器立项到实现整个过程,并讲解了其使用方法。但是它们并不能全部涵盖所有重要内容,所以新开一片博文,用来讲述其中一些杂项。...XDEBUG_SESSION_STOP_NO_EXEC=netbeans-xdebug         这种方法存在明显缺陷。比如我们一个待测功能页,我们不可能给每个触发调试URL增加上述标志。...在此之前肯定有一次获取该用户已有信息请求,然后把用户信息显示出来。用户修改时,可能有些信息还要经过PHP逻辑校验,这些也是请求。...这样随着我们调试次数增多,session指令获取会话ID会越来越多,而往往大部分都是无效。对于我们自动选择调试会话调试器状态机来说这个工作任务会越来越重,所以这个地方需要做优化。...父子(孙)进程管理         在我初步设想,我们只要让调试器Python代码在一个进程执行,然后以其为父进程,启动一个执行Pydbgp库python子进程进程。

65920

【测开技能】Java语言系列(一)Java入门

前言 在测开系列文章分享,分享了一些脚本,但是没有系统对于某个语言进行过系统与分享,这次接着对于Java语言基础复习机会,对java语言入门进行系统分享,希望能够帮助大家学习...Java可以编写桌面应用程序、Web应用程序、分布式系统和嵌入式系统应用程序等。...)缩写,一种软件设计典范,用于组织代码用一种业务逻辑和数据显示分离方法 Java 开发工具有哪些呢?...$PATH export CLASS_PATH=$JAVA_HOME/lib windows需要在环境变量配置。...然后运行输出了结果 这样第一个java程序就开发完成了。 发现问题,解决问题。遇到问题,慢慢解决问题即可。

43710

跨平台PHP调试器设计及使用方法——探索和设计

嵌入在PHP执行程序Xdebug开启了一个80端口 控制调试过程IDE发起一次HTTP调试请求 Xdebug根据配置项remote_host和remote_port字段(也就是IDE所在机器...IP和IDE开放端口),向IDE发起连接请求 IDE和Xdebug建立连接,相互通信 Xdebug应答2过程HTTP请求         上述方式存在一个问题,就是要在Xdebug里配置好IDE...面对这两种方式,我们需要如何选择呢?...首先我们看一个问题,如果配置过netbeans和Xdebug连接朋友,肯定记得netbeans要配置代码FTP地址。...虽然xdebugsource命令可以获取当前执行文件内容,而对于一款调试器来说,我们往往需要很多尚未发生内容。所以IDE要能访问远程文件是必要

93910

使用Java在Netbeans IDE上开发JavaFX4个深坑总结,开发必看!

netbeans教程太少了。最后还是去官方找了一段时间才找出来解决办法。当然,我们这篇文章主题是如何netbeans上面开发javafx程序,不是情绪抱怨。我们开始吧。...netbeans就不支持ant javafx项目的创建,r了我们直接创建普通ant项目即可。...填写完成后如下所示,然后我们点ok但是这个事还没完,它还在报错,看下图:第四个深坑:这里必须要在这个项目的属性把 compile on svae默认选项给取消掉。...就还有个netbeans中文输出output窗口乱码事儿也让人无语。哎。用惯了eclipse,idea聪明让人觉得世间ide不都是应该配合自己么,这个netbeans偏偏别扭很。...以上是关于如何netbeans上面开发javafx项目的4个深坑总结。如果这篇文章对你有帮助请点赞收藏加关注哦!创作不易。也感谢大家阅读!

2.6K00

RadRails1.0降临——增加Profiler、CallGraph Analyzer和Rails Shell等新特性

这里有一个RadRails、Netbeans和CodeGears3rdRail特性完全比较,比较可以看出RadRails在重构(refactoring)和性能剖析(profiling)方面更胜一筹...RadRails1.0支持Ruby代码性能剖析,可以通过GUI显示每个方法运行时间和调用图表。...Christopher解释了这是如何实现: 此Profiler是ruby-prof gem一个简单包装。...我们将从ruby-profbin脚本得到ruby脚本执行包装起来,并将输出定向到一个临时文件。然后,当执行结束 时候,我们通过解析输出并生成调用图表和着重点以供查看。...(这样我们便可得到快照,而非等到程序结束后再从 输出获得)。

1.9K80

H2数据库教程_h2数据库编辑数据库

您可以保存并重复使用以前保存设置。设置存储在属性文件(请参阅H2控制设置)。 错误消息 错误消息显示为红色。您可以通过单击消息来显示/隐藏异常堆栈跟踪。...支持路径名空格。不得引用设置。 使用H2控制台 H2控制应用程序有三个主要面板:顶部工具栏,左侧树和右侧查询/结果面板。数据库对象(例如,表)列在左侧。...如果您没有系统托盘图标,请导航至[首选项]并单击[关闭],在启动服务器控制台中按[Ctrl] + [C](Windows),或关闭控制台窗口。 特殊H2控制台语法 H2控制台支持一些内置命令。...在Web应用程序中使用数据库 有多种方法可以Web应用程序访问数据库。...还有其他更复杂开源连接池,例如Apache Commons DBCP。对于H2,内置连接池获取连接速度比获取连接池快两倍DriverManager.getConnection()。

5.2K30

2023年稳定PyCharm激活码

PyCharm稳定激活码: ➡️ 下面链接直接获取即可,免费+最新+实时获取 https://www.kdocs.cn/l/ct26lfHmgpJP 2023年最新PyCharm激活码:https://...支持Google App引擎 用户可选择使用Python 2.5或者2.7运行环境,为Google APp引擎进行应用程序开发,并执行例行程序部署工作。...集成版本控制 登入,录出,视图拆分与合并--所有这些功能都能在其统一VCS用户界面(可用于Mercurial, Subversion, Git, Perforce 和其他 SCM)得到。...图形页面调试器 用户可以用其自带功能全面的调试器对Python或者Django应用程序以及测试单元进行调整,该调试器带断点,步进,多画面视图,窗口以及评估表达式。...可自定义&可扩展 可绑定了 Textmate, NetBeans, Eclipse & Emacs 键盘主盘,以及 Vi/Vim仿真插件。

3.8K20

Java 中文官方教程 2022 版(十三)

如果您计划将 RIA 部署为具有一定管理控制企业 Java Web Start 应用程序,则可以将应用程序预加载到各个客户端,以便缓存并准备使用。...本课程描述了如何使用 Ant 任务创建这些捆绑包。 其他参考资料 有关自包含应用程序更多信息,请参阅 Java 平台标准版部署指南中自包含应用程序打包。...关于文件关联演示更多信息 文件关联演示项目包含了应用程序 Java 源文件,位于/src/sample/fa目录。自定义图标位于/src/package/platform``目录。...该库被放置在项目的/lib目录应用程序使用。 然后,该目录被复制到生成自包含应用程序/dist目录。 build.xml文件-pre-init任务以下代码显示如何下载库: <!...只要在 TicTacToe 目录没有不需要文件,你可以使用以下替代命令来构建 JAR 文件: jar cvf TicTacToe.jar * 尽管详细输出没有显示,Jar 工具会自动向 JAR 存档添加一个路径名为

5100

可视化工具gephi源码探秘(二)---导入netbeans

在上篇《可视化工具gephi源码探秘(一)》主要介绍了如何将gephi源码导入myeclipse遇到一些问题,此篇接着上篇而来,主要讲解当下通过myeclipse导入gephi源码可行性不高以及熟悉...今日梗概:   今天一天都在困惑如何让源代码跑起来以及究竟是选择在myeclipse跑还是在netbeans跑。   ...点击完成后会先从maven远程库中下载一些必要jar包,因为此前是netbeans小白,所以新建项目后不知道如何拷贝gephi源码,只是讲pom.xml内容换成了gephi源码自带pom.xml...4.这时又想到gephi这个项目似乎是没有main函数,也就是说没有正常项目那样入口,所以于如何启动哪启动问题也是一个心结,一顿搜索后发现问题总是很多,解决相对较少,我不是第一个有这样疑惑的人...,但也不是第一个知道这个问题答案幸运儿,最终给我感觉还是说netbeans可以指定一个启动入口或者说netbeans对于桌面应用程序具有特殊处理使得不需要想一般程序一样通过main函数讨论(当然

1.6K80

汇编寄存器规则

需要注意是,该应用程序不会实时显示寄存器值; 它只能在特定函数调用期间显示寄存器值。...触发断点后在 LLDB 控制台中键入以下内容: (lldb) register read 这将列出处于暂停执行状态所有主要寄存器。 但是输出了太多信息。...在 LLDB 控制台中键入以下内容: (lldb) po $rdi 然后你会看到如下输出: 它输出了 RDI 寄存器...您只需创建一个断点就可以轻松调试,寄存器获取引用并根据需要操纵该对象实例。 您现在将尝试将主窗口更改为红色。”...接下来,在 LLDB 控制台中键入以下内容: (lldb) finish 命令会结束完成函数执行并停住调试器。这时,函数返回值会在 RAX 内。

2.4K50

谁才是接口测试工具C位?

今天就继续跟大家讲一下接口测试工具,因为常常被大家问到接口测试工具该如何选择,谁才是接口测试最好用工具,哪种工具是必须要学习,以及测试工具该如何学习”。 ?...前端作用就是显示页面和数据,做一些简单校验,比如说非空校验等。 后端:在前端页面上各种操作后各种控制处理,比如访问数据库,进行数据更新等,比如购物,你在付款时,后端去控制扣你余额。...Fiddler 要比其他网络调试器要更加简单,操作便捷,格式显示清晰,这个工具也可以进行接口测试,但是不能写断言,只能用composer构造HTTP请求,需要人工确认返回结果正确性。...该工具既可作为一个单独测试软件使用,也可利用插件集成到Eclipse,maven2.X,Netbeans 和intellij中使用。...,通过jmeter+ant+jenkins可以实现接口和性能自动化测试。

80820

iOS开发 Xcode各种调试、DEBUG

具体这样做:(僵尸只能用在模拟器和OC语言) 控制台(lldb 命令) LLDB 是一个有着 REPL 特性和 C++ ,Python 插件开源调试器。...LLDB 绑定在 Xcode 内部,存在于主窗口底部控制台中调试器允许你在程序运行特定时暂停它,你可以查看变量值,执行自定指令,并且按照你所认为合适步骤来操作程序进展。...(这里有一个关于调试器如何工作总体解释。) 你以前有可能已经使用过调试器,即使只是在 Xcode 界面上加一些断点。但是通过一些小技巧,你就可以做一些非常酷事情。...参考: 与调试器共舞 - LLDB 华尔兹 LLDB调试命令初探 About LLDB and Xcode The LLDB Debugger 基础 help 在控制台输入help,显示控制台支持lldb...模拟器调试 编译并运行应用程序,选中模拟器, Debug菜单中选择Color Blended Layers选项。

2.1K50

14个你可能不知道JavaScript调试技巧

用表格显示对象 有时, 有一组复杂对象要查看。可以通过查看并滚动浏览,亦或者使用展开,更容易看到正在处理内容! 输出: 3....如何快速找到DOM元素 在Elements面板中标记一个DOM元素,并在控制台中使用它。Chrome控制台会保留选择历史最后五个元素,最终选择首个元素被标记为,第二个选择元素为,依此类推。...快速查找要调试函数 假设你要在函数打断点,最常用两种方式是: 在控制台查找行并添加断点 在代码添加 在这两个解决方案,您必须在文件单击以调试特定行。 使用控制台打断点可能不太常见。...在控制台中输入,当调用时,将以调试模式停止: 9. 屏蔽不相关代码 现在,我们经常在应用引入几个库或框架。其中大多数都经过良好测试且相对没有缺陷。 但是,调试器仍然会进入与调试任务无关文件。...在复杂调试过程寻找重点 在更复杂调试,我们有时希望输出很多行。可以做就是保持良好输出结构,使用更多控制台函数,例如, , , , , 等等。然后,可以在控制台中快速浏览。

1.7K90

如何在Electra越狱设备上使用LLDB调试应用程序

将你iOS设备连接到USB。 接着在Xcode你应该看到,如下红框内所示信息: ? 等到“准备调试支持iPhone”完成。...然后在Mac控制台中运行: ? 最后,将iPhone连接到USB。就是这样,我们准备开始。 将LLDB attach到已经运行进程 在你Mac控制台上,连接iPhone: ?...在iPhone控制台中运行 ? 找到你想要attach进程pid。然后运行 ? 如果你看到和我类似的内容 ? 则表明运行一切正常。现在,在Mac上打开另一个控制台,然后运行 ?...在LLDB控制台中运行 ? 在LLDB下运行应用程序 在你Mac控制台上,连接iPhone: ? 在iPhone控制台中运行 ? 如果你看到和我类似的内容 ? 则表明运行一切正常。...如果你遇到了错误则, 在没有调试器情况下运行应用程序 如前一节所述,将调试器attach到应用程序 关闭(LLDB)应用程序 尝试在调试器下再次运行应用程序 *参考来源:kov4l3nko,FB小编

2.3K40
领券